Yep, hadn't seen that in decades :o) I remember growing up at the ranch and we'd see various butterflies puddling on cow patties :o) as well as any puddle that formed after a rare rainfall.

There are gobs of GSTs at the ranch right now. I must have counted at least 30 on the 7/10 mile dirt road from the house to the windmill. Which, by the way, we finally fixed. It had been broken for months and the pond was completely dried up. Lots of deer and feral hog tracks in the dried mud where they were looking for water. I re-dug the small trench that leads to the pond and planted banana trees along both sides of it. Put a piece of metal gutter under the water pipe so that the water would hit the metal and make noise. Sure sounds like a babbling brook :o) Can't wait until next weekend to see what else shows up. That's the only water source in that couple hundred patch of land.
